Construction and infrastructure projects make use of river sand. River sand adds strength, bulk, and adhesive properties to construction materials like cement, brick, asphalt, and concrete. It is also used in landscaping projects. However, since 2010, several regional governments and countries, including Cambodia and India, have prohibited the export of river sand. Sand mining causes erosion of river banks, which has a negative impact on biodiversity. Furthermore, river sand is depleting rapidly due to extensive mining. In addition, most infrastructure and construction projects are located away from riverbanks.
Further, the use of natural river sand is expected to be banned in most countries in the near future, which will have a positive impact on the use of artificial sand. Government regulations, rising prices, and limited availability of natural sand drive the demand for artificial sand by construction project owners. The number of construction projects is expected to increase, which will drive the demand for artificial sand during the forecast period. Such factors will drive the growth of the market during the forecast period.
Cone-crushing equipment produces more hydrocarbons (HC), nitrogen oxides (NOx), carbon monoxide (CO), and particulate matter (PM) than highway vehicles. The emission of such harmful pollutants by construction equipment has compelled pollution control boards and environmental bodies in various countries to develop stringent emissions standards for construction equipment. The United States and the European Union have the most stringent rules for construction equipment, and they intend to implement additional rules to help reduce emissions. The aim of adhering to these emission standards in developing nations is to make construction equipment emissions obsolete.
Moreover, with changing emission guidelines and the increased popularity of greener and cleaner equipment, manufacturers are innovating solutions to reduce the consumption of fuel and finding alternatives to diesel for operating the crushing equipment. Some manufacturers are developing new engines that run on hybrid drive systems (hybrid-electric systems), propane fuel, and hydrogen as alternatives to diesel. These fuels are not only environmentally friendly but also cost-effective. Thus, the increasing demand for less carbon emission equipment will drive the growth of the market during the forecast period.
The cone-crushing process, essential for various industries, brings environmental concerns, notably dust generation. Airborne dust from cone crushers, a byproduct of rock or mineral crushing, poses respiratory risks for workers and compromises air quality nearby. Dust suppression measures like water spraying and enclosure systems are common but may not entirely solve the issue. Moreover, raw material extraction for cone crushing contributes to habitat destruction, deforestation, and soil erosion, particularly in mining operations. Energy consumption, especially in regions relying on nonrenewable sources, adds to greenhouse gas emissions.
However, companies investing in eco-friendly practices could gain a competitive edge, but initial costs may deter some. Public awareness and concern for environmental issues may influence purchasing decisions, favouring responsible equipment and processes. Cone crusher stakeholders must invest in green technologies to ensure sustainable market growth, facing potential regulatory scrutiny and constraints without such measures. This environmental challenge is anticipated to impede mining activities, hindering market growth during the forecast period.
The diesel segment is estimated to witness significant growth during the forecast period. A diesel-powered cone crusher uses a diesel engine to power its hydraulic system. The diesel engine provides the power required to operate both the crusher and the hydraulic systems that control the equipment's functions. This type of cone crusher is especially useful in remote areas where access to electricity is limited or unreliable.

The diesel segment was the largest and was valued at USD 1,301.23 million in 2018. Diesel-powered cone crushers offer enhanced versatility and mobility, facilitating easy transportation to various job sites. Their revenue advantage over electric and hybrid counterparts is driven by preferences in off-grid or remote areas, where establishing a reliable electric power source is challenging. Diesel engines, with superior torque and suitability for heavy-duty applications, contribute to increased efficiency and productivity. Key vendors producing diesel-powered cone crushers include Terex Corp., Metso, and McCloskey International, each offering solutions tailored to mining, construction, and diverse industry needs. The choice between diesel, electric, or hybrid-powered cone crushers depends on operational requirements, power source accessibility, and environmental considerations. With their higher reliability, diesel-powered cone crushers are poised to drive market growth during the forecast period.
Based on the application, the market has been segmented into mining, construction, and recycling. The mining?segment will account for the largest share of this segment.? Cone crushers play an important role in the mining industry, crushing hard materials efficiently and reliably. Primary crushing involves reducing large ore or rock chunks in the initial stages, while secondary crushing prepares the material for further processing. Tertiary and quaternary stages refine particles for efficient downstream processes. Notable vendors like Metso Outotec, Sandvik AB, and Thyssenkrupp offer mining-specific cone crushers, emphasizing efficiency and reliability. The mining sector's growth, driven by global demand for metals and minerals, expanding operations into challenging locations, and technological advancements in cone crusher technology, contributes significantly to the market. Increasing steel production, particularly in China, reinforces the demand for efficient mining solutions, positioning cone crushers as vital components for productivity and profitability in the mining sector. These trends underscore the growth potential of the segment during the forecast period.

APAC is estimated to contribute 36% to the growth by 2028. Technavio's analysts have provided extensive insight into the market forecasting, detailing the regional trends and drivers influencing the market's trajectory throughout the forecast period. Between 2020 and 2022, substantial infrastructure projects in China and India, as well as plans by South-East Asian nations like Indonesia and the Philippines, are set to drive the demand for construction equipment. India, with numerous public-private partnership (PPP) projects, aims to invest heavily in smart cities and the power sector, attracting significant foreign investment. Infrastructure and township projects, fueled by population growth and rising incomes, will be key drivers for crushing equipment in India.
Meanwhile, China's government initiatives and tax relaxations on infrastructure investments are fostering construction activities, particularly in residential building construction, driven by urbanization and increased income levels. The resulting demand for housing will significantly boost the market in both India and China, making these regions key contributors to the global growth of cone crushers during the forecast period.
